2230 /* There are two ways to manage the TX descriptors on the tigon3.
2231  * Either the descriptors are in host DMA'able memory, or they
2232  * exist only in the cards on-chip SRAM.  All 16 send bds are under
2233  * the same mode, they may not be configured individually.
2234  *
2235  * This driver always uses host memory TX descriptors.
2236  *
2237  * To use host memory TX descriptors:
2238  *      1) Set GRC_MODE_HOST_SENDBDS in GRC_MODE register.
2239  *         Make sure GRC_MODE_4X_NIC_SEND_RINGS is clear.
2240  *      2) Allocate DMA'able memory.
2241  *      3) In NIC_SRAM_SEND_RCB (of desired index) of on-chip SRAM:
2242  *         a) Set TG3_BDINFO_HOST_ADDR to DMA address of memory
2243  *            obtained in step 2
2244  *         b) Set TG3_BDINFO_NIC_ADDR to NIC_SRAM_TX_BUFFER_DESC.
2245  *         c) Set len field of TG3_BDINFO_MAXLEN_FLAGS to number
2246  *            of TX descriptors.  Leave flags field clear.
2247  *      4) Access TX descriptors via host memory.  The chip
2248  *         will refetch into local SRAM as needed when producer
2249  *         index mailboxes are updated.
2250  *
2251  * To use on-chip TX descriptors:
2252  *      1) Set GRC_MODE_4X_NIC_SEND_RINGS in GRC_MODE register.
2253  *         Make sure GRC_MODE_HOST_SENDBDS is clear.
2254  *      2) In NIC_SRAM_SEND_RCB (of desired index) of on-chip SRAM:
2255  *         a) Set TG3_BDINFO_HOST_ADDR to zero.
2256  *         b) Set TG3_BDINFO_NIC_ADDR to NIC_SRAM_TX_BUFFER_DESC
2257  *         c) TG3_BDINFO_MAXLEN_FLAGS is don't care.
2258  *      3) Access TX descriptors directly in on-chip SRAM
2259  *         using normal {read,write}l().  (and not using
2260  *         pointer dereferencing of ioremap()'d memory like
2261  *         the broken Broadcom driver does)
2262  *
2263  * Note that BDINFO_FLAGS_DISABLED should be set in the flags field of
2264  * TG3_BDINFO_MAXLEN_FLAGS of all unused SEND_RCB indices.
2265  */

2705         /* If the IRQ handler (which runs lockless) needs to be
2706          * quiesced, the following bitmask state is used.  The
2707          * SYNC flag is set by non-IRQ context code to initiate
2708          * the quiescence.
2709          *
2710          * When the IRQ handler notices that SYNC is set, it
2711          * disables interrupts and returns.
2712          *
2713          * When all outstanding IRQ handlers have returned after
2714          * the SYNC flag has been set, the setter can be assured
2715          * that interrupts will no longer get run.
2716          *
2717          * In this way all SMP driver locks are never acquired
2718          * in hw IRQ context, only sw IRQ context or lower.
2719          */
2720         unsigned int                    irq_sync;
2721
2722         /* SMP locking strategy:
2723          *
2724          * lock: Held during reset, PHY access, timer, and when
2725          *       updating tg3_flags and tg3_flags2.
2726          *
2727          * netif_tx_lock: Held during tg3_start_xmit. tg3_tx holds
2728          *                netif_tx_lock when it needs to call
2729          *                netif_wake_queue.
2730          *
2731          * Both of these locks are to be held with BH safety.
2732          *
2733          * Because the IRQ handler, tg3_poll, and tg3_start_xmit
2734          * are running lockless, it is necessary to completely
2735          * quiesce the chip with tg3_netif_stop and tg3_full_lock
2736          * before reconfiguring the device.
2737          *
2738          * indirect_lock: Held when accessing registers indirectly
2739          *                with IRQ disabling.
2740          */
2741         spinlock_t                      lock;
